What are cookies?
"Cookies" are small files with information that a website (specifically the web server) stores on a user's computer, so that every time the user connects to the website, the latter retrieves the information in question and offers the user related to these services. A typical example of such information is the user's preferences on a website, as indicated by the choices the user makes on the specific website (e.g. selection of specific "buttons", searches, advertisements, etc.).

Strictly necessary cookies
Strictly necessary cookies are essential for the website to function properly. They allow you to browse and use its functions, such as accessing secure areas or using the shopping cart. They do not recognize your individual identity in any way. Without them, we cannot offer efficient operation of the website.

Performance cookies
They collect information about how visitors use the website. They also collect aggregated, anonymous information that does not identify any visitor. They are used exclusively to improve the performance of a website.

Functionality cookies
They allow the site to remember user choices such as username or region to provide enhanced and personalized features. The information collected by this type of cookies is anonymous and it is not possible to track browsing activity on other websites.

Targeting cookies
They are used to provide content that is more relevant to you and your interests. They may be used to display targeted advertising/offers, limit ad impressions or measure the effectiveness of an advertising campaign.
